Mirametrix
provides three products together for eye tracking: S2 Eye
Tracker, Viewer eye tracking software and an API.
The products are offered together in one affordable eye
tracking package.
The S2 Eye Tracker is
a portable hardware device that sits just below the computer
screen. It calibrates almost instantly and holds calibration
extremely well, allowing it to work consistently across
subjects. It runs on most Windows computers, and can be used
at a variety of locations, both in and out of the lab.
The system supports casual head movements, and provides a
distraction-free test environment that ensures natural
behaviour, and therefore valid results. Accuracy is
achievable within the range of 0.5 to 1 degree, ensuring
reliable research results.

The Eye Tracking
Viewer software is a simple-to-use program for recording
an eye tracking session. The eye tracking software works in
the background and creates a video of the screen, overlaid
with red dots for tracking the eye, showing exactly where
the user is looking at that moment in time. It can also save
the eye gaze data as an XML or CSV document for simple

The Eye
Tracker API provides a simple way to interface with the
S2 Eye Tracker. The S2 Eye Tracker API requires no software
download whatsoever. You can access the API documentation
and begin integrating with any other application that
supports TCP/IP for data communication and XML data
structures.
Using this API, Mirametrix has published their Mirametrix
Toolbox for MATLAB. The toolbox lets you access eye gaze

S2 Eye Tracker Technical Specifications
Accuracy: 0.5 degree range
Drift: < 0.3 degrees
Data rate: 60 Hz
Freedom of head movement: 25 x 11 x 30 cm (Width x
Height x Depth)
Calibration: 5, 9 point (~ 15 seconds to complete),
long lasting
Binocular tracking: Yes
Tracking type: Bright pupil
Supports: Eye glasses (particularly 3D), head
tilting, head shaking, excessive blinking
Physical Dimensions: 35 x 4 x 3 cm (Width x Height x
Depth)
Weight: ~0.3 kg (0.7 lbs)
Eye Tracking Viewer Software
The S2 Eye Tracker comes
with the Eye Tracking Viewer Software, which is used to
monitor, track and record eye gaze data. As a subject uses a
computer equipped with the S2 Eye Tracker, Viewer can be
used to record a video of the on-screen activity, which
includes exactly where the user is looking. By using a
second monitor, this video can even be shown as it is being
recorded. Below is a video recorded by Eye Tracker Viewer

S2 Eye Tracker API
The S2 Eye Tracker supports an open standard eye-gaze
interface. The interface uses TCP/IP for data communication
and XML for data structures. Our vision is to see this API
adopted by many eye tracker developers, providing
application developers a standardised interface to eye gaze
hardware. For now this easy to use and free eye tracker API
provides a simple way to interface with the S2 Eye Tracker.
